Can you take CoQ10 with L-Carnitine?
L-carnitine is an important partner of both CoQ10 and essential fatty acids. It first guides the essential fatty acids into the mitochondria of the cells, at which point the L-carnitine collaborates with CoQ10 to transform the fatty acids into energy for the heart.
What should you not take CoQ10 with?
What drugs and food should I avoid while taking Coq10 (Ubiquinone (Coenzyme Q-10))? Avoid using ubiquinone together with other herbal/health supplements that can also lower blood pressure. This includes andrographis, casein peptides, cat’s claw, fish oil, L-arginine, lycium, stinging nettle, or theanine.

How quickly does D-ribose work?
Research into ribose supplementation* has proven that taking as little as 3-5grams per day will return cellular levels of ATP to normal within 6-22 hours of exhaustive exercise. Without supplementation, this is likely to take between 26 and 93 hours.
Does CoQ10 help hair growth?
Research has connected CoQ10 with increased cellular energy and blood flow which can help support the high energy demands of your hair follicles. CoQ10 may also stimulate the gene responsible for producing different types of hair keratins, especially the ones that are reduced during aging.

Does CoQ10 make you poop?
Side effects from CoQ10 seem to be rare and mild. They include diarrhea, nausea, and heartburn.
